Why does the time for 20 complete oscillations need to be taken

Respuesta :

melbert445
melbert445 melbert445
  • 14-04-2022

✏Answer ✏

The short answer is to reduce the uncertainty in your measurement of the period. ... If you are using a stopwatch and manual timing- then your uncertainty in timing an interval is likeley to be about say 0.2 s . If the period of the pendulum is about 1 second then 0.2 s uncertainty corresponds to about 20% .
